SQL/MP Programming Manual for COBOL

Introduction
HP NonStop SQL/MP Programming Manual for COBOL529758-003
1-3
SQL/MP Statements and Directives
Table 1-1. SQL/MP Statements and Directives
Type Statement or Directive
Data Declaration BEGIN DECLARE SECTION and END DECLARE SECTION
INVOKE
INCLUDE STRUCTURES
INCLUDE SQLCA, INCLUDE SQLDA, and INCLUDE SQLSA
Data Definition
Language (DDL)
ALTER CATALOG, ALTER COLLATION, ALTER INDEX, ALTER
PROGRAM, ALTER TABLE, and ALTER VIEW
COMMENT
CREATE CATALOG, CREATE COLLATION, CREATE INDEX,
CREATE PROGRAM, CREATE TABLE, and CREATE VIEW
DROP
HELP TEXT
UPDATE STATISTICS
Data Manipulation
Language (DML)
DECLARE CURSOR
OPEN
FETCH
SELECT, INSERT, UPDATE, DELETE
CLOSE
Data Status
Language (DSL)
GET CATALOG OF SYSTEM
GET VERSION (for SQL/MP software, catalogs, and objects)
GET VERSION OF PROGRAM
Dynamic SQL
Operations
PREPARE
DESCRIBE and DESCRIBE INPUT
EXECUTE and EXECUTE IMMEDIATE
RELEASE
Error Processing WHENEVER
Transaction Control BEGIN WORK, COMMIT WORK, and ROLLBACK WORK